Christmas trees in Sherwood


By Sharon Roberson


December 21st, 2006 ·

We found the greatest place in Sherwood to cut down our Christmas tree.  It is a family-run business, Stein’s, and is located off Elwert Road. There are holiday crafts for sale in the home and has a very warm and welcoming feel. 

There’s usually plenty of parking available around the house.  They provided us with a wheelbarrow and saw and we started our short 1/8 mile hike to the 5-acre “forest”.  The trail is a bit muddy so not the best for strollers and those that need easy access.  We really felt like we could have been in a mini forest.  The kids got to run off some energy and the experience just added to the Christmas feel.

We got to choose our tree, any tree, for $35!  There are many varieties and sizes to choose from.  What a deal! They did have a tractor available for those that weren’t up to pulling/carrying their tree back to the car. The best part is that it was only a five minute drive from our home, so we were able to get the tree up, decorated and enjoy more family time.
